Cash Flow Forecasting: Planning for Future Financial Needs

Cash flow forecasting is a crucial aspect of financial planning for businesses and individuals alike. It involves estimating future cash inflows and outflows over a specific period, enabling better decision-making and resource allocation.

What is Cash Flow Forecasting?

Cash flow forecasting helps predict the liquidity position of a business or individual. It provides insights into when cash will be available and when it may be needed, allowing for proactive financial management.

Importance of Cash Flow Forecasting

Understanding cash flow forecasting is vital for several reasons:

  • Financial Planning: It helps in planning for future expenses and investments.
  • Identifying Trends: It allows businesses to identify seasonal trends in cash flow.
  • Preventing Shortfalls: It helps in preventing cash shortages that could disrupt operations.
  • Informed Decision Making: It supports strategic decisions regarding growth and expansion.

Key Components of Cash Flow Forecasting

To create an effective cash flow forecast, consider the following key components:

  • Cash Inflows: Include all sources of income, such as sales revenue, investments, and loans.
  • Cash Outflows: Account for all expenses, including fixed costs, variable costs, and discretionary spending.
  • Time Frame: Determine the period for forecasting, which can range from weeks to years.
  • Assumptions: Clearly outline assumptions regarding sales growth, expense increases, and economic conditions.

Steps to Create a Cash Flow Forecast

Creating a cash flow forecast involves several steps:

  • Step 1: Gather historical data on cash inflows and outflows.
  • Step 2: Estimate future cash inflows based on sales projections and other income sources.
  • Step 3: Project cash outflows based on fixed and variable expenses.
  • Step 4: Create a cash flow statement to visualize inflows and outflows over the forecast period.
  • Step 5: Review and adjust the forecast regularly to reflect changes in the business environment.

Tools for Cash Flow Forecasting

Several tools can assist in cash flow forecasting:

  • Spreadsheets: Programs like Microsoft Excel or Google Sheets are commonly used for creating cash flow forecasts.
  • Accounting Software: Tools like QuickBooks and Xero offer built-in forecasting features.
  • Financial Planning Software: Dedicated software solutions provide advanced forecasting capabilities.

Common Challenges in Cash Flow Forecasting

Despite its importance, cash flow forecasting can present challenges:

  • Inaccurate Estimates: Overestimating inflows or underestimating outflows can lead to cash shortfalls.
  • Economic Uncertainty: Changes in the economy can impact sales and expenses unpredictably.
  • Lack of Historical Data: New businesses may struggle without a historical basis for projections.
  • Complexity: Managing multiple cash flow sources and expenses can complicate forecasting.

Best Practices for Effective Cash Flow Forecasting

To improve the accuracy and effectiveness of cash flow forecasting, consider these best practices:

  • Regular Updates: Update forecasts regularly to reflect actual performance and changing conditions.
  • Scenario Planning: Prepare for different scenarios (best case, worst case) to understand potential impacts.
  • Engage Stakeholders: Involve team members from finance and operations to gather diverse insights.
  • Monitor Key Metrics: Keep an eye on key performance indicators (KPIs) that affect cash flow.

Conclusion

Cash flow forecasting is an essential tool for effective financial management. By understanding its components, following best practices, and utilizing appropriate tools, businesses and individuals can better prepare for their future financial needs.